The crew of *Supernova* performs extensive maintenance and upgrades while docked in a marina, including replacing a leaking water pump and installing a new lithium iron phosphate battery bank. The 24-volt, 230-amp-hour lithium batteries total 400 kilograms and require multiple trips to transport from the dock to the boat.7:19 To manage the weight and tide, the crew uses an electric winch to pull the vessel close to the wall.4:21 The leaking water pump is temporarily bypassed by placing it in a bin to catch drips until a replacement arrives.7:58

The crew also modifies their solar panel installation plan after receiving viewer feedback regarding boom clearance and sail access.9:37 They fabricate and weld stainless steel mounts for the panels, adhering to strict fire-watch protocols required by the marina.13:11 Professional sailmakers install the mainsail and headsail, a task that requires removing the solar panels to prevent damage.19:53 The crew identifies a broken zipper on the sail cover and plans to repair it rather than replace the entire assembly.23:38
